The Peak District
We are in a perfect location for exploring the hills, caverns, towns
and dales of the North Peak District in Derbyshire which hosts many activities in
rolling countryside perfect for walking, cycling or sight seeing. The highest
Peak, Kinder Scout is only 3 miles from the farm. Site of the famous
mass trespass it offers excellent hill walking and stunning views.
